There is strong and growing evidence from both particle physics and astrophysical observations for the existence of physics Beyond the Standard Model that has so far evaded direct discovery in high-energy colliders.
The Beam Dump Facility (BDF) at SPS will offer unrivalled luminosity for the SHiP experiment to search directly for as yet, undiscovered, low mass Feebly Interacting Particles at a luminosity some three orders of magnitude higher than the High Luminosity LHC, in a parameter range not accessible to the LHC experiments.
